### Step 4: Migrate the retention sweeper

Stop the legacy Pondwick sweeper before enabling the new one; running both deletes records twice and breaks the audit trail. Copy the retention windows from the old unit file into the new sweeper's config exactly — do not round intervals, downstream billing in Marrowfield depends on them. Dry-run mode must stay on for the first 24 hours. Once the dry run completes cleanly, apply the production configuration shown below.

settings of tagag-kawep:
OLIAEL_HOST=oliael.zemvarsys.internal
OLIAEL_PORT=5672

Finance should treat this as a material exposure: a contract lapse would compress margins within two quarters. Mitigations underway include diversifying into the Kettleholm region, accelerating the Tidewatch product line, and renegotiating payment terms to shorten receivables. Quarterly exposure reporting moves from ad hoc to standing agenda item. Contingency modelling is owned by the planning group. Context for these moves appears in the confidential note below.

confidential, kagup-bafog: Fraaxax Group is in early talks to buy Soroxox Group for about $343.8 million. The Olidor launch date is June 14, and nothing goes to the press before then. Legal wants the Aldmirek Logistics term sheet signed before July 23.

- [ ] Step 7: Archive cold storage buckets (Glacierline tier). Confirm both ceremony witnesses are present, verify bucket manifests match the Oxbow ledger, then seal the archive key shares. Plugin authors may observe but not handle shares. Once sealed, the archive index itself is encrypted and can only be reopened with the passphrase below.

vault phrase of badup-hahig = tamael-aldael-kelmir-istael-fenok-istwyn-tamius-jorath-oliion

### Meeting notes — Tansy calendar sync

We dug into the double-booking bug again. Turns out two-way sync with Fernholm calendars writes conflicting event versions when both sides edit within the debounce window. Agreed fix: last-writer-wins plus a conflict log, shipping next sprint. Future maintainers: don't touch the debounce timing without reading the log first. Point of contact is below.

account owner for fajep-yagef: Kasix Eliiel